What is Bullet?
Bullet, formerly Zeta Markets, is a decentralized perpetual futures exchange built on Solana's first network extension purpose-built for trading. It offers up to 100x leverage on markets including SOL, BTC, and ETH perps, with capital efficiency features that let users trade perps, spot, and borrow/lend from one account. Bullet's infrastructure is secured by ZK proofs posted on Solana L1, providing transparency and verifiability. The platform supports multi-collateral deposits, allowing users to use their favorite assets as collateral while earning yield. Its L2 architecture is resistant to L1 congestion, enabling ultra-fast and reliable trade execution. The $ZEX token is migrating to $BULLET on a 1:1 basis, serving as the network token for gas fees, node operations, and staking on the Bullet network extension.
